Bands Ditch Metal Fest After Kyle Rittenhouse Announced as Special Guest

https://www.rollingstone.com/music/music-news/kyle-rittenhouse-metal-fest-booking-bands-drop-out-1235125091/

Several bands have dropped out of an upcoming metal festival in Orlando after Kyle Rittenhouse was announced as a special guest.
